Abstract

A third generation (3G) gateway ( 30 ) provides the facilities for extending a number of internet protocols ( 40, 64, 74, 83, 100, 110, 120 and 130 ) between a second generation (2G) network and a 3G network. The various messages of a session initiation protocol (SIP) are extended to provide user identification and server identification subfields ( 42 ). The SIP message extensions facilitate the communication of 2G and 3G networks for the purposes of implementing push-to-talk and dispatch service features.
